冒充(他人);假扮身份,尤指意图欺骗。
To pretend to be (a different person); to assume the identity of, especially when there is an intent to deceive.
以不同用户账户的权限进行操作;模拟(用户)。
To operate with the permissions of a different user account.

Not this
He was arrested for impersonating as a police officer.
Use this
He was arrested for impersonating a police officer.
impersonate 是及物动词,直接接被冒充的对象,不需要介词 as;不能说 impersonate as somebody。
Not this
The comedian's impersonate of the singer was hilarious.
Use this
The comedian's impersonation of the singer was hilarious.
这里要用名词形式 impersonation 表示“模仿/扮演”,所有格后接名词,不能用动词原形 impersonate。
Not this
He impersonated to be a doctor to get in.
Use this
He impersonated a doctor to get in.
impersonate 后直接接名词作宾语,不能像 pretend 那样接 to be 不定式;要说 impersonate somebody。

The suffix '-ate' has two common pronunciations: /eɪt/ in verbs (e.g., communicate, concentrate) and /ət/ in adjectives and nouns (e.g., fortunate, private, affectionate). 'Impersonate' is a verb, so its ending is pronounced /eɪt/ like the verb examples. Watch out for lookalikes ending in '-ate' that sound different.
